Nokia N76 Review By LaptopMag

The N76’s 2-MP camera delivered very good details in our tests with a bit of color degradation. Videos are recorded at 320 x 240 pixels and 15 frames per second.

LaptopMag Reviewed Nokia N76 and gave out “Multimedia is this clamshell’s biggest strength. Music playback from the external stereo speakers was impressive, and we like the addition of a normal headphone jack. The N76 supports virtually every audio format under the sun, including AAC, MP3, and WMA filesWe did encounter a problem with the design: The 3.5mm jack is located on the top of the phone, so it’s impossible to completely open this clamshell while the headset is plugged in.”
